> I dual boot my gentoo box with Windows 98.  Whenever I boot into Gentoo my 
> clock is always 3.5 hours ahead of what it should be.  in /etc/rc.conf I 
> have the clock set to local and I have the timezone set to 
> America/New_York.  If I boot into Windows98 the clock is always 
> correct.  Any ideas?

You need the proper timezone setup in Linux - it's not clear from your
description whether you have that. The /etc/localtime should be a symbolic
link to a file like "../usr/share/zoneinfo/EST5EDT"
